Fasal Bima Yojana: Cut-off date extended
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

The Ministry of Agriculture and Farmers Welfare has extended the cut-off date for submission of insurance proposals to 10th August, 2016 by relaxing its provisions in the wake of receiving a number of requests from various States.

This being the first season for implementation of Pradhan Mantri Fasal Bima Yojana(PMFBY) an extension of cut-off date on account of various reasons including delay in carrying out the requisite preliminaries and consequential delay in notification were felt.

The matter has been considered and Ministry of Agriculture and Farmers Welfare has decided to extend the cut-off date for submission of insurance proposals upto and including 10th August, 2016 by relaxing provision of Para IX (3 & 4) of Operational Guidelines of PMFBY & Weather Based Crop Insurance Scheme, reads a PIB release.

All cut-off dates for subsequent activities should accordingly be extended. This extension is valid only for crops where cut-off date earlier was 31st July, 2016. Earlier also Ministry extended the cut-off date for submission of insurance proposals under PMFBY upto 2nd August, 2016, it adds.

This is a one-time extension only and should not to be quoted as precedent in future. State Government may consider taking appropriate action regarding extension of cut-off date accordingly as deemed fit and inform all stakeholders including SLBC/Banks, it stated.
